Performance of Top 5 Historical Games on Android in South Africa for Q1 2023
In the first quarter of 2023, historical games on the Android platform in South Africa showcased interesting trends in terms of weekly downloads, revenue, and active users. Here are the key insights from the top 5 historical games, based on data from Sensor Tower.
Royal Match
The game from Dream Games, Ltd. saw a varied performance in Q1 2023. Weekly revenue showed a steady increase, peaking at approximately $37.7K in mid-March. Weekly downloads fluctuated, starting at around 7.8K and stabilizing near 9K towards the end of the quarter. Active users also exhibited growth, ending the quarter at about 85.2K.
Rise of Castles: Ice and Fire
Long Tech Network Limited's game had mixed results. Weekly revenue ranged from $8.2K to $11.5K, showing some fluctuations throughout the quarter. Downloads declined from 2.2K at the start to around 539 by the end. Active users also saw a downward trend, decreasing from 6K to approximately 3.9K.
June's Journey: Hidden Objects
Wooga's title experienced a peak in weekly revenue of about $6.9K towards the end of March. Downloads varied, starting at 1.8K and ending around 1.1K. Active users showed a slight decline, from approximately 9.6K to 7.9K throughout the quarter.
King's Choice
ONEMT SGP's game saw stable weekly revenue, peaking at $5.9K in late January and maintaining around $5.2K by the end of March. Downloads began at around 926 and tapered off to approximately 562. Active users were relatively stable, ending the quarter close to 4.2K.
Rise of Kingdoms: Lost Crusade
LilithGames' offering had a steady weekly revenue, peaking at $4.3K in mid-March. Downloads fluctuated, starting at around 920 and dropping to about 334 by the end of the quarter. Active users saw a slight decline, from around 5K to roughly 4.6K.
